Position 1: Accounting Manager

As an Accounting Manager, you will oversee financial operations, lead the accounting team, and manage budgeting, reporting, and compliance efforts. This role requires strong leadership skills and the ability to optimize financial processes, oversee audits, and drive financial strategy in collaboration with senior management.

 

Key Responsibilities:

·       Lead and manage finance personnel, providing guidance and training.

·       Prepare and review financial reports, including monthly statements and summaries.

·       Oversee contract management, debt obligations, and compliance with financial policies.

·       Coordinate annual audits and liaise with external auditors.

·       Manage project accounting, grants, and intergovernmental financial applications.

·       Supervise cash flow, ensuring funds are available for contractual obligations.

·       Develop and implement financial policies, procurement processes, and RFP/RFQ documentation.

·       Collaborate with leadership on budget planning and financial forecasting.

·       Monitor and improve financial processes to ensure efficiency and compliance.

 



Requirements

Qualifications & Skills Required:

Education: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Business Administration, or a related field.
Experience: Minimum 6+ years in managerial accounting, public administration, or a financial leadership role.
Technical Skills: Strong knowledge of financial reporting, budgeting, auditing, and grants management.
Leadership & Communication: Ability to manage teams, drive financial strategy, and present to senior leadership.
Analytical & Detail-Oriented: Strong problem-solving, forecasting, and critical-thinking skills.
